crashing
KRA-shihng
adjective
1
Extreme or overwhelming, often used to intensify a negative quality.
"The evening ended in a crashing bore of a speech."
noun
1
The loud sound made by something colliding or falling violently.
"The crashing of waves against the rocks kept her awake."
